Aniket Maurya

Aniket enhanced the Lightning-AI/LitServe repository by delivering maintenance and governance improvements focused on code quality and scalability. He refactored internal loop logic into class methods using Python, applying object-oriented programming principles to improve encapsulation and maintainability. Aniket updated the test suite to align with the new class-based structure, ensuring continued reliability. He also revised the CODEOWNERS file in YAML to add new default reviewers, streamlining the pull request process and supporting better onboarding. Through these changes, Aniket strengthened the repository’s review coverage and governance, reducing contribution cycle times and lowering the risk of regressions, demonstrating thoughtful, foundational engineering work.
